A three-dimensional unsaturated-zone flow model was developed using Hydrus-3D (PC-Progress, Inc.) to simulate managed aquifer recharge at the Southeast Houghton Artificial Recharge Project (SHARP) in Tucson, AZ. Recharge, up to about 4,000 acre-feet per year, takes place at three surface basins. The model simulates variable-saturated flow in the unsaturated zone and groundwater mounding. The local-scale model (2 km x 2 km) does not simulate regional groundwater flow. The model was calibrated using groundwater-level data, repeat microgravity data, and PEST++ model calibration software. Additional information about the model and results is in the U.S. Geological Survey Scientific Investigations report 2025-5017 (https://doi.org/10.3133/sir20255017). Running the model requires a (paid) license for Hydrus-3D software.
